## Authentication

Grovepad uses role-based access, so what a user can do depends on their role: readers browse, editors write, and stewards manage page permissions. Most support tickets about "missing pages" are really role mismatches — check the user's role first before digging deeper. Role changes take effect on next login, which trips people up constantly. For support tooling, you'll query the roles endpoint directly rather than the UI; it's faster and shows pending changes too. Authenticate those requests with the internal key below.

gateway credential: kto3_qfe

**Break-Glass Access — Verdanta Greenhouse Controller**

When sensor drift on the Verdanta humidity array exceeds calibration bounds, the controller may lock out normal admin sessions as a safeguard. Reviewers should note that break-glass entry requires two-person approval and is logged to the Fernhollow audit stream. To restore emergency access, enter the recovery passphrase printed below.

unlock words, yawig-kagef: gordor-holvan-ulaael-pramir-ulaiel-tamdor

Ticket #4471 — TerraNote offline mode failing in staging. The field-survey app's offline sync was pointed at the production queue because the staging environment file was copied without edits. Surveyors in the Kelbrook pilot saw cached forms upload to the wrong tenant. Fix is straightforward: regenerate the staging env file from the template and rotate the sync credential before Thursday's cut. For the release build, the corrected file must include the line that sets the sync secret.

env line for fafof-fahag: LEDGER_TOKEN5=f8790